Why teams connect Ceridian Dayforce and Streak CRM

Keep the people who own accounts in Streak CRM in step with the workforce records in Ceridian Dayforce, so ownership, roles, and org structure stay current in both systems, in real time and in both directions.

Streak CRM runs on people as much as on accounts: every contact, deal, and account has an owner, and those owners are employees whose roles, teams, and status are held in Ceridian Dayforce. Ceridian Dayforce is the system of record for the workforce, from new hires to promotions to departures, and often for the candidates the business is still deciding on. When the two systems are connected only by re-keying or an overnight export, they drift apart, and the CRM ends up assigning accounts to people who have left, holding territories that no longer match the org chart, and waiting days to give a new rep access.

Stacksync syncs Organizations, Tasks, Email threads, Custom fields in Streak CRM with Employee Punches & Raw Clock Entries, Employee Schedules, Org Units, Departments, Jobs & Positions, Time Away From Work & Balances in Ceridian Dayforce field by field, in real time, and in both directions. You decide which system owns which fields, so Ceridian Dayforce stays authoritative on roles and org structure while Streak CRM keeps ownership and territory current, and Stacksync resolves conflicts by the rules you set.

How the Ceridian Dayforce and Streak CRM connectors work

Ceridian Dayforce

Integration surface
REST API (Dayforce RESTful Web Services, v1/v2), JSON payloads
Authentication
HTTP Basic authentication with a dedicated Web Services user plus the client namespace (Company ID), or an OAuth 2.0 access token from the Dayforce identity endpoint (POST dfid.dayforcehcm.com/connect/token, client_id Dayforce.HCMAnywhere.Client). Token-based auth is recommended, and the Web Services role with the Read Data subfeature must be enabled on the account.
Change detection
No CDC stream. Broad change detection uses delta polling on GET Employees with filterUpdatedStartDate/filterUpdatedEndDate and filterUpdatedEntities to pull only records changed in a window. Dayforce also has native Event Notifications (the Notification Publisher) for lifecycle events — hire, rehire, terminate, and workflow validation — delivered by push to a receiver service or by querying unacknowledged notifications; the publisher runs roughly hourly and each notification must be acknowledged.
Capabilities
read · write · webhooks
Rate limits
Dayforce does not publish numeric rate limits; thresholds vary by tenant and exceeding them returns HTTP 429, so large employee reads are paged (pageSize) and throttled with backoff. Employee list calls return XRefCodes only, so each employee needs a follow-up GET.

Streak CRM

Integration surface
REST API
Authentication
API key issued per user
Change detection
Polling against pipeline, box, and contact endpoints; Streak's automations can send outbound webhooks on higher plans
Capabilities
read · write
Rate limits
Subject to the platform's API rate limits; quotas are not prominently published
